FNDB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2020 in Review

69 of the 4,877 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Schwab Fundamental US Broad Market Index ETF (FNDB) for Q2 2020, worth a combined $53.9M — down 14% from $62.3M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 8 funds closed out of FNDB and 6 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 32 trimmed existing stakes and 16 added.

The largest buyer was Royal Bank of Canada, adding an estimated $2.7M. The largest seller was Opes Wealth Management, cutting an estimated $7.23M.
